STMicroelectronics reveals IR sensor for presence and motion detection in building automation
STMicroelectronics is launching a novel human-presence and -motion detector to enhance security systems, home-automation equipment, and IoT devices that typically use passive infrared (PIR) sensing. The STHS34PF80 sensor contains thermal transistors that can detect stationary objects, unlike conventional PIR detectors…
